Problem
Rohan has 4 fish tanks holding 90 guppies in total. Each tank has a few more guppies than the one before: tank 2 has 1 more than tank 1, tank 3 has 2 more than tank 2, and tank 4 has 3 more than tank 3. We need the number of guppies in tank 4.

How to solve
Strategy Guess and Check

This is a multiple-choice problem and the unknown is exactly the number we are asked for (guppies in tank 4). Each answer choice fully determines all four tanks by walking backwards (tank 3 = tank 4 - 3, tank 2 = tank 3 - 2, tank 1 = tank 2 - 1). We can test a single choice, add the four numbers, and see if it equals 90 — Tool #6. Combined with Tool #3 we can eliminate any choice whose total is not 90, and Tool #1 (a quick row of 4 boxes) keeps the four tanks straight.

1STEP 1

Draw 4 boxes for the tanks and mark the gaps +1, +2, +3 — knowing any one tank now fixes all four.

T₁ → T₂ → T₃ → T₄
2STEP 2

Guess the biggest choice for Tank 4, then step backward: Tank 3 = 23, Tank 2 = 21, Tank 1 = 20 — all whole numbers, a good sign.

T₄=26, T₃=23, T₂=21, T₁=20
3STEP 3

Add the four counts in friendly pairs: 20+21=41 and 23+26=49, so the total is 90 — the guess works.

20+21+23+26 = 41+49 = 90 ✓
4STEP 4

Because Tank 4 fixes all four tanks, only one choice can total 90 — e.g. (A) 20 gives sum 66, too small. So the biggest choice stands.

Choice (E)colon 20+21+23+26=90 → (E)
Answer
26
Check the magnitude: if all four tanks held the same amount, each would hold 90 ÷ 4 = 22.5. Tank 4 should be a bit bigger than 22.5 because it has the most extras (+1+2+3 over Tank 1). Our answer 26 is just a few above 22.5 — that fits perfectly. The four numbers (20, 21, 23, 26) are all positive whole numbers and add to 90, matching every condition in the problem.
